In the United States, $937 billion was spent on hospital care in 2013 (the most recent year for which data is available), two-thirds of which was related to surgical services. 1 Approximately 100 million surgeries are performed each year in the U.S., over half of which are done in ambulatory facilities. WebDisclaimer: The ACS NSQIP Surgical Risk Calculator estimates the chance of an unfavorable outcome (such as a complication or death) after surgery. The risk is estimated based upon information the patient gives to the healthcare provider about prior health history. The estimates are calculated using data from a large number of patients who had a surgical … WebAug 9, 2024 · Clinicians are often asked to evaluate a patient prior to surgery. The medical consultant may be seeing the patient at the request of the surgeon or may be the primary care clinician assessing the patient prior to consideration of a surgical referral. The goal of the evaluation of the healthy patient is to detect unrecognized disease and risk ... WebAug 9, 2024 · The goal of the evaluation of the healthy patient is to detect unrecognized disease and risk factors that may increase the risk of surgery above baseline and to propose strategies to reduce this risk. The evaluation of healthy patients prior to surgery is reviewed here.
